Work in the Yokohama Shipyard
I was putting the ships together,
erecting the ships as they built them,
all the steel work.
I think there was 150 fellas in our gang
when we started and we were down to 30
by the time we left there and
they all had to be put on
a lighter type of work, this was just too
heavy for them, a lot of them, you know,
they are all getting weaker all the time.
But we sort of made the best of it at work,
we got our Jap boss we had we sort of
convinced him that we could do better work
if we were left on our own,
without other Japs with us because we
were continuously getting in fights with them
and so forth, so the boss finally did and
we did enough work so that he
sort of left us alone.
He would come and tell us what
he wanted done and
we would do it and it gave us a chance
that if somebody wanted a chance to take
off and try and steal something or, you know,
this sort of thing that we could cover
up for him and he could do
that and it made it a little easier.
I mean the work was still hard and
you still had to do so much or
you wouldn’t get away with it.
